Jim Simons is the founder of Renaissance Technologies, one of the most successful quantitative hedge funds in the world. Before his career in finance, he served as a mathematics professor and made significant contributions to differential geometry. Simons applied his analytical expertise to develop sophisticated, algorithm-driven trading strategies, earning consistently high returns for investors.

Jim Simons's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2017, Jim Simons held 3,587 positions worth $85B, up 8.4% from $78.4B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 8.5% of the portfolio.

Jim Simons deployed $2.91B of net new capital in Q3 2017, opening 418 new positions and adding to 1,684 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was ExxonMobil: 3,652,454 shares worth $299M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 16% of assets, down from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Financials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Electronic Arts, an estimated $280M trimmed.
